Home›Support›English Support›[Resolved] WooCommerce Multilingual: can't save Stripe Country availability
[Resolved] WooCommerce Multilingual: can't save Stripe Country availability
This thread is resolved. Here is a description of the problem and solution.
Problem: The client is unable to save the 'Country availability' setting for the Stripe Payment Gateway in WooCommerce when WooCommerce Multilingual is enabled. After attempting to save the setting and refreshing the page, the setting appears not to be saved, and a warning about saving the page is displayed.
I am trying to:
Restrict payment methods offered in WooCommerce based on the offered parameter Country availabilité > Specific countries.
This setting is only offered when WooCommerce Multilingual is enabled
I can add the setting, but I can apparently save it (as it's stated at the bottom left of the page), but as soon as I try to refresh the page, it gets obvious the setting wasn't saved, since I get a warning about saving the page. Finally, once refreshed, the setting is empty.
Link to a page where the issue can be seen:
Stripe payment gateway settings
I expected to see:
Parameter saved after refresh
Instead, I got: Parameter not saved after refresh
I will add the first reply before this ticket is assigned to one of my colleagues.
Would you please follow the steps below and test to see if there is a compatibility issue or some sort of JS problem?
- IMPORTANT STEP! Create a backup of your website. Or better approach will be to test this on a copy/staging version of the website to avoid any disruption of a live website.
- Switch to the default theme such as "TwentyTwenty" by going to "WordPress Dashboard > Appearance > themes".
- See if the issue is fixed.
If the issue persists, I'd appreciate it if you could give me the URL/User/Pass of your WordPress dashboard after you make sure that you have a backup of your website.
It is absolutely important that you give us a guarantee that you have a backup so if something happens you will have a point of restore.
I understand the issue you're having. I would like to inform you that our development team has already identified the issue with selecting a country in the Stripe Payment Gateway settings.
We have documented the issue in an errata, which also includes details about a workaround. Please refer to the errata provided below, apply the suggested workaround, and then see if you're getting the expected results.
OK, I'll keep relying on that patch for now...
By the way, beware I can't fill the "How your issue was resolved?" form while confirming the resolution of this issue. The radio button won't work.
So I'd say: " The problem is not fully resolved, but I don’t need more help now"